What is brachyradium therapy and where can you undergo it?
Brachyradium therapy is a unique
therapeutic method that utilizes the healing effects of the
radioactive isotope radium (Ra-226). This treatment is administered through special so-called "
Jáchymov boxes," which contain a controlled amount of
radium and are placed directly on the patient’s skin near affected areas. Thanks to the targeted action of
radioactive radiation, it provides
pain relief and reduces inflammation, especially in cases of
chronic musculoskeletal disorders.
You can exclusively undergo this procedure at the
Jáchymov Spa in the Czech Republic. Specialized facilities like the
Radium Palace hotel and the
Akademik Běhounek hotel provide this therapy. They have extensive experience with this method and ensure treatment is performed according to strict safety standards.
Since this therapy involves exposure to
radioactive radiation, it must always be carried out under professional supervision and after careful assessment of the patient’s health condition. Before starting the treatment, a
medical consultation is always necessary to verify the suitability of the procedure and conduct all required examinations.
